I still like the game and bet on a frequent basis. Over this time period I have wagered on a type of vingt-et-un called "The Take it Leave it Method". You certainly won’t get flush with this method or beat the casino, however you will have an abundance of fun. This method is based on the fact that chemin de fer appears to be a game of runs. When you are hot your hot, and when you are not you’re NOT!

I gamble with basic strategy blackjack. When I lose I bet the lowest amount allowed on the subsequent hand. If I do not win again I wager the lowest amount allowed on the successive hand again etc. Whenever I hit I take the payout paid to me and I bet the original wager again. If I win this hand I then leave the winnings paid to me and now have double my original wager on the table. If I win again I take the payout paid to me, and if I win the next hand I leave it for a total of 4 times my original bet. I keep wagering this way "Take it Leave it etc". Once I lose I lower the action back down to the original bet.

I am very strict and do not "chicken out". It gets very thrilling sometimes. If you win a few hands in a row your wagers go up very quick. Before you know it you are gambling $100-200/ hand. You have to understand that you can give away a great deal faster this way too!. But it really makes the game more exciting. And you will be aghast at the streaks you see wagering this way. Here is a chart of what you would wager if you continue winning at a five dollar game.

Bet $5
Take 5 dollar paid to you, leave the first five dollar bet

Bet 5 dollar
Leave 5 dollar paid to you for a total wager of ten dollar

Bet $10
Take ten dollar paid-out to you, leave the first ten dollar bet

Wager 10 dollar
Leave 10 dollar paid-out to you for a total wager of $20

Bet twenty dollar
Take 20 dollar paid-out to you, leave the original twenty dollar bet

Bet 20 dollar
Leave 20 dollar paid-out to you for a total wager of forty dollar

Wager forty dollar
Take forty dollar paid-out to you, leave the initial $40 bet

Wager 40 dollar
Leave $40 paid to you for a total wager of $80

Bet $80
Take eighty dollar paid to you, leave the original 80 dollar wager

Wager $80
Leave eighty dollar paid-out to you for a total bet of 160 dollar

Bet 160 dollar
Take $160 paid-out to you, leave the first 1 hundred and 60 dollar bet

If you departed at this moment you would be up 315 dollar !!

It’s herculean to go on a streak this long, but it can happen. And when it does you mustn’t alter and drop your bet or the end result won’t be the same.
